> > http://build-failures.rhaalovely.net/powerpc64/2024-03-18/devel/py-thrift,python3.log
>
> doesn't produce compiled extension on ppc64.
py-thrift has invalid C code on all big-endian platforms, so it can't
build its C extension. Back in February 2023, I wrote a potential fix
at https://github.com/apache/thrift/pull/2754 but I got stuck, unable
to post to their bug tracker. I put my diff in one of my ports trees,
but never shared the ports diff.

> segfault during build
Nobody can use gdb to debug these segfaults, because ports/devel/gdb
segfaults at runtime. I learned that gdb uses C++ exceptions, and all
such exceptions segfault on powerpc64. I began trying to fix it in
base llvm/libunwind, but the fix is not ready.
